Output 684e7936457500c8e87cc539653f3ddbaef81f0a2e4de8e8f0f4c49da42d2b3c:0

value
5162100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6a01eb76314342eb8eb3e5301083e64fe2587d OP_EQUAL
address
3MbtDtk8tvfdyEwwj2xuaKoovMbF7XrWjT
transaction
684e7936457500c8e87cc539653f3ddbaef81f0a2e4de8e8f0f4c49da42d2b3c
spent
true